How they compare

Tanzania currently reports 68.96 trillion constant LCU against 52.11 trillion constant LCU in Chile, a difference of 16.85 trillion constant LCU.

That makes Tanzania's figure about 1.3 times Chile's.

The two have swapped places 1 time across 36 shared years of data; in 1990 it was Chile ahead.

Globally, Chile ranks 13th and Tanzania ranks 10th of 167 countries.

Gross fixed capital formation includes acquisitions less disposals of fixed assets during the accounting period, including certain specified expenditures on services that add to the value of non-produced assets. This indicator is expressed in constant prices, meaning the series has been adjusted to account for price changes over time. The reference year for this adjustment varies by country. This series is expressed in local currency units.
